
Hebrews 2:14-16 – “Inasmuch then as the children have partaken of flesh and blood, He Himself likewise shared in the same, that through death He might destroy him who had the power of death, that is, the devil, 15 and release those who through fear of death were all their lifetime subject to bondage.” NKJV
Attempting to guard against going into something deeper than I should I want to address a few more things about the blood of Jesus and His relationship to Adam’s blood. Jesus, the Bible declares was “born of a virgin” making Him man but not sharing the blood of Adam. That in itself is incredible. Had he been the child of Joseph and Mary He would have shared Adam’s blood and been a partaker of all that Adam was or the depravity of man. Therefore, Jesus had a human body but blood for a separate source.
In the text verse, we read the word children which clearly is human children. Those children are said to be partakers of Flesh and Blood. Then it speaks of Jesus and says that He himself likewise took part of the same. The word “took part” as applying to Christ is completely different than the word “partakers” as it refers to the children.
The word, “took part” implies “taking part in something outside oneself.” The Greek word for “partakers” is KOYNONEHO and means “to share fully.” Therefore, all of Adam’s descendants or children share fully in Adams’ flesh and blood. Then we read that Jesus “took part” and the word used is METECHO which means “to take part but not all.” The children took both flesh and blood of Adam, but Christ took only part. He took the flesh part where the blood was a result of a supernatural conception.
Jesus, therefore, was a perfect human being after the flesh. He was the seed of David according to the flesh.
